John D'Leo (born July 8, 1995) is an American actor. He is known for
his role in the 2013 film The Family, opposite Robert De Niro,
Michelle Pfeiffer, and Dianna Agron. D'Leo is from Monmouth County. He
is of Italian and Irish descent. He has also appeared in the films
Unbroken (2014), Cop Out (2010), Brooklyn's Finest (2010), Wanderlust
(2012), and The Family (2013) and on the television series Law &
Order: Special Victims Unit and How to Make It in America.
